Why the Fujifilm 16-55mm F2.8 Is Necessary
I find the Fujifilm 16-55mm F2.8 necessary because it gives me the most useful range in one lens. From wide-angle shots at 16mm to short telephoto at 55mm, I can cover landscapes, street scenes, portraits, and everyday moments without changing lenses. That flexibility makes my shooting faster, simpler, and much more reliable.
My biggest reason for loving this lens is the constant F2.8 aperture. It helps me keep strong low-light performance and gives me better control over depth of field, which makes my photos look more professional. Whether I am shooting indoors, in the evening, or trying to isolate a subject, I know I can depend on it.
I also feel this lens is necessary because of its image quality. The sharpness, contrast, and overall clarity are excellent across the zoom range, so I do not feel like I am sacrificing quality for convenience. For me, it is the kind of lens that can stay on the camera most of the time and still handle almost any situation.

What I Like Most
What I like most is the balance between versatility and quality. I do not have to compromise too much on sharpness just because I am using a zoom lens. The constant F2.8 aperture is another major benefit for me because it keeps exposure more consistent while zooming.
What I Would Think Twice About
Before buying, I would think carefully about the size and weight. This is not the kind of lens I would choose if I wanted something compact and lightweight. If I prioritize portability above all else, I might find it a bit heavy for all-day carry. I would also consider whether I truly need this level of performance, because it is more of a premium investment.
